Why you should know the exact weight of the boat
The primary reason for the weighing is road safetyPassenger cars have a strictly regulated maximum mass of the towed trailer. If the total weight of the boat, engine, fuel, battery and trailer exceeds this limit, the braking efficiency of the car will decrease sharply, which can cause an emergency.
The law also requires accurate data for registration The discrepancy between documentary evidence and reality can lead to problems with document checks on the water or during transportation, especially for boats that do not formally require registration but may exceed thresholds in the amount of the engine.
⚠️ Warning: Exceeding the permissible weight of the trailer can be the basis for a fine from the traffic police, as well as the reason for refusal to pay insurance compensation in the event of an accident.
Knowing the exact weight is also necessary for proper selection. transom-wheel An overloaded trailer wears down the bearings and tires faster, and regular mass monitoring allows you to detect the accumulation of excess cargo, such as water in the hold or unnecessary equipment, which is stored in the handoos for years.
Weigh the boat along with permanent equipment: anchor, safety cable and a full tank of fuel to get a real picture of the load.

Weighing method on platform scales
The most accurate and simple way is to use car or floor platform-weightThese devices can be found at cargo terminals, scrap metal reception points, recreation centers or weightbridge centers, the principle of operation is simple: the entire kit (motorized boat on a trailer) is driven to the platform as a whole.
To get the net weight of the craft, two measurements are required. train Then you unplug the tractor, and you weigh only the trailer and the boat, and the difference between those two values, given the mass of the tractor, will give the desired result. If you can weigh the empty trailer separately, the accuracy will increase.

The main advantage of this method is to minimize human error, so you don't have to do complicated maths or shift loads. margin of error Large scales can be up to 20-50 kg, which is a significant value for light PVC boats. For metal boats, this accuracy is quite acceptable.
Nuances of the use of industrial weights
Not all scales allow cars with trailers to drive on them. Check the platform dimensions and axle load in advance. Sometimes you need to pay for each race, so plan the sequence of actions so that you do not pay twice for unnecessary maneuvers.

Use of suspension and crane scales
Small boat owners, especially inflatable boats PVC Or aluminum "sands," which would be a great solution if you had a scale, and this requires a lifting mechanism, a crane, a crane, or even a strong crossbar between two supports, and the boat is suspended by a special loose bolt or sling that covers the hull.
The key here is the right thing to do. centre-upThe suspension point must be placed strictly above the boat's center of gravity, otherwise it will tilt and the weight readings will be incorrect. It often takes several attempts to find balance. For metal boats with an outboard motor, this method allows you to weigh the kit as a whole if the weighting capacity of the scales allows (usually up to 500-1000 kg).
It is important to use certified cargo-grabbingSlings must be wide so as not to damage the sides of the boat, especially if it is PVC. The hook of the scales must be securely fixed. This method is good for its mobility - compact electronic scales are easy to carry in the trunk.
Calculation methods and formulae
In extreme cases, when scales are not available, you can use a calculation method, although its accuracy leaves much to be desired, based on Archimedes' law and knowledge of displacement. mass In case of the body from the passport and the weight of the engine, you can try to estimate the total weight by adding standard coefficients for equipment.
The formula looks something like this: M_general = M_hull + M_motor + M_fuel + M_equipmentHowever, practice shows that manufacturers often specify the minimum weight of the case, and reality makes its own adjustments: the thickness of the fiberglass layers, the amount of applied gelcoat or the thickness of the aluminum sheet can vary.
A more precise but time-consuming method is the displacement of water, which is only theoretically applicable to small vessels or individual elements. empiricalFor example, boats add 15-20% to their passport weight for "non-accounting", and the engine weight is taken from the passport with the addition of 5 kg for oil and mounting.
The calculation method is only acceptable for approximate estimation, and is not suitable for official registration or trailer selection due to the high error margin.

Where can I find the weight of my outboard motor?
Exact weights are given in user manual (manual) under "Specifics" and you can find this information on the manufacturer's official website in the model specifications, remember that the weight in the manual is usually indicated without oil or fuel.
